Peri-implantitis Implantoplasty Treatment

Sponsor: University of Oslo

View on ClinicalTrials.gov

Summary

This double arm, split-mouth, single centre, controlled, randomised clinical study is designed to examine the effect of implantoplasty in treatment of peri-implantitis. Peri-implantitis will be treated with open flap debridement, with or without implantoplasty.

Official title: Surgical Peri-implantitis Treatment With and Without Implantoplasty

Interventions

PROCEDURE

Implantoplasty

Implantoplasty is the mechanical smoothening of rough titanium implants as part of the surgical treatment of peri-implantitis. Treatment is thought to facilitate self-performed oral hygiene.
